The average train between Oxford and Staplehurst takes 2h 37m and the fastest train takes 2h 15m. There is an hourly train service from Oxford to Staplehurst.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run hourly between Oxford and Staplehurst. The earliest departure is at 12:11 AM at night, and the last departure from Oxford is at 10:01 PM which arrives into Staplehurst at 12:36 AM. All services require a transfer at London Paddington and take an average of 2h 37m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Oxford to Staplehurst. However, there are services departing from Oxford station and arriving at Staplehurst station via London Paddington.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 37m.

The distance between Oxford and Staplehurst is 141.3 km. The road distance is 173 km.
You can take a train from Oxford to Staplehurst via London Paddington, Paddington station, Charing Cross station, and London Charing Cross in around 2h 29m.
